题解 1117: K-进制数

来看看其他人写的题解吧!要先自己动手做才会有提高哦! 
返回题目 | 我来写题解

筛选

K-进制数-题解(C++代码)

摘要:解题思路:注意事项:参考代码: #include<iostream> using namespace std; int main() { int n,k,a0,a1,i;//n表示位数……

K-进制数-题解(C++代码)动态规划解法

摘要:解题思路:       其实说是动态规划,我觉得这更像一道数学题。       样例输入给了我们2位数的十进制情况下的答案,90.       我们不妨从这个地方入手,去求三位数的十进制情况下的答案。……

K-进制数-题解(C++代码)——深搜版

摘要:# 思路 **!!!写给自己!!!** 因为两个相邻数位不能都是零,所以可以从最高位开始进行分配数字,因为可以重复,所以这个数位从0开始或从1开始完全由上一位是否为0决定,所以在DFS函数中加入形……

K-进制数-题解(C++代码)

摘要:1、大佬的优秀代码 感觉有点像是递归的思想 链接:[https://blog.dotcpp.com/a/56751](https://blog.dotcpp.com/a/56751) ```……

K-进制数-题解(C++代码)

摘要:# 解法 使用排列组合的方式解答该算法。题目要求N位K进制数不能出现连续两个0,并且首位数不能为零。由此满足题目要求的N位K进制数有以下几种情况: 1. 该数不含有0:满足情况的数的数目为nu……

K-进制数-题解(C++代码)

摘要:题意: 一个n位数,遵守k进制,相邻的两位不能是0且第一位不能是0 解题思路: 每一位都有k种选择,分别是0~k-1(but第一位不能是0,为1~k-1,所以要单独判断),对每一位进行枚举,……